The testimonies of Karupayee and Ramar, wife and son of Servaaran, from the Fact-finding Investigation Report into the alleged murder of Servaaran a Dalit Panchayat president from Thirunelveli District, March 2007

Human Rights – Kalam, Tirunelveli, Human Rights Advocacy and Research Foundation (HRF) together with Human Rights Forum for Dalit Liberation (HRFDL) commissioned a Fact Finding Investigation into the death of Servaaran – Dalit Panchayat President, belonging to the Arundatiyar Community (Sub caste among Dalits) of Marthankinaru Panchayat, Kuruvikulam Panchayat Union, Tirunelveli District on 19.02.07.

Mrs. Karupayee, Age 55/07 W/o Late. Servaraan Muruthankinaru
I am residing in Arunthathiyar colony of Maruthankinaru Village. My husband M. Servaraan s/o Mookandi was the Panchayat President of Maruthankinaru elected in October 2006. I have two sons and three daughters. My first son Ramar who is married, is working in a private school at Nagerkoil. My second son Perumal is also married, now working as daily wage labourer in Kottayam. My two daughters Pechhi, Ganapathi are married and living with their husbands. My last daughter Kali aged 19 is unmarried and lives with me and works in the match industry. My husband is an agricultural labourer. On 19.02.2007 (Monday) he took his torchlight and a stick at approximately 5.30 am to go to the toilet in a nearby thorn bush. At around 6.00 am Kaliammal D/o Ramar a relative came to my house with my husband’s torchlight. She told me that my husband is lying down dead in the bush area. I was shocked and ran to the spot. My relatives, neighbours, Murugan s/o Saravaraan also came with me to the spot.
I found my husband’s body lying facing the ground in the thorn bush and he was dead. The stick he used and one of his slippers was lying near by.
Mr. Harikrishnan and a section of the Thevars supported my husband during Panchayat election. Harikrishnan’s wife Poolammal was Village Panchayat President for 15 years. But for all practical purposes Harikrishna functioned as the defacto Panchayat President. They assured us that if any problems arose they would support us”. So my husband contested in the election and became the president. Even after he became the President he worked as Thotti of the Panchayat Office. He was not allowed to sit in his chair after becoming president. Once when officers from B.D.O office came in January he was permitted to sit in his chair.
In the 2nd week of January Vice-President Sumati and her husband Neelaraja Rathinam did some development works without the knowledge of my husband like street lights, changing the drinking water pipeline etc., My husband questioned them for this. In retaliation Sumathi (Vice-President) in front of many people, abused my husband using the most foul language and cursing him about his caste. Her husband also scolded my husband. So my husband registered a complaint against both of them twice in Panavadali Chatiram Police Station. The Police Officials called Sumati, and her husband to the Police Station. The called my husband also. They did not take any action against Sumathi and her husband.
Sumati and her husband threatened my husband for giving a complaint against them. My husband used to discuss all these problems with me and my daughter. We didn’t disturb our son as they are working outstation.
We are sure that Vice-President Sumathi and her husband Neelaraja Ratinan killed my husband.
Ramar, S/o Servaaran :-
I have studied upto 9th Std. My father helped us in education. My father was working as servant to Harikrishnan’s family. Harikrishnan financially helped us sometimes. 300 thevar families supported my father during elections. The other 300 thevars supported Chelladurai. Mr.Harikrishnan only spent Rs.50,000 for my father. My father also spent some of his own money during election. The present Vice President Sumathi and her family supported another candidate Chelladurai.
After elections, problem arose between Sumathi and my father. She and her husband Neelaraja Ratinam once abused my father saying “You Sakkiliyan dog, how dare you not obey us”. After this incident my father filed complaint in Panavadali Police Station. But the police being in favour of Sumathi the case was just compromised. The second time also my father filed a complaint in the same station, but no action was taken. If they had taken any action, this death would not have happened. Our father was a sweeper in Panchayat Office located in the Thevar’s area.
Often my father complained to my mother about the threats by the Vice-President. If we knew about these threats in advance we would have asked him to resign from the post. Police Officials and others tried to portray that my father was suffering from heart problem is a false statement. Three months ago my father had chickun Kunia fever and was treated for that. Otherwise he is a strong and healthy person.
On 19.2.07 early morning around 5.00am he went to the toilet in pallar’s area as we don’t have separate place for toilet. As it is very dark he took one stick and torch light with him. After sometime a relative girl R. Kaliammal who had also gone to toilet found a torch lying on the ground. She switching on the torch light and found Servaaran lying down on the ground. She came running and informed my mother and brother. We noticed swelling on the throat and chest. We tried to give him soda, did some first aid as we couldn’t believe that our father was dead. In the meantime Harikrishnan went and informed the police. Then D.S.P and Panavadali Police Inspector came to our house. They took my father’s body to Sankaran Koil Government Hospital. The police first registered a case under sec 174. After the protest by 300 people and various organisations police changed the FIR to sec 302 SC & ST Act. We received the body in the evening. After that the rituals and we buried our father.
I believe that the reasons for my father’s death is
- Dominant caste hatred for dalits especially Arunthathiyar. They could not tolerate that a dalit being a president
- Complaint of my father in the police station against Vice President
- He refused to function as benamy president to Vice President.

In response to the brutal attack on Thalaiyuthu Panchayat President Krishnaveni, this is the ninth of a series of posts about attempts on the lives of dalit panchayat presidents. This attack has hospitalised an award-winning and popular elected leader and underlines the threat that caste poses to democracy.
